Does “Free Will” Exist?
This is an argument that I’m still working on so please tell me if or where you think I’m wrong here.
1 – Anything that is restricted, limited, regulated, or is contained in any way cannot be fully free.
2 – In order to have “will” there needs to be a being, be it biological or A.I. system, that has, creates, or acts upon it.
3 – These beings, either biological or A.I. systems, are either restricted, limited, regulated, or contained in some way.
4 – Although these beings can have more or less of these restrictions, limitation, regulations or be more or less contained in given circumstances or contexts, some form of these things will still be a part of these systems.
Therefore, “Free” will, defined here as being fully free, does or cannot exist.

Top 5 Ways to Break Final Fantasy VIII
#5. Drawing Magic from the Islands Closest to Heaven and Hell
This is #5 because it can’t be accessed until Disc 3 and I want to focus on breaks early on in the game. On these islands are multiple draw points for Ultima, Full-Life, Meteor, Triple, and Aura, all of the best Junctioning magic (except for Pain and Meltdown which I will cover in #1). Enc-None will allow you to quickly draw from them and hop from one island to another. Do both islands between the events of Disc 3 to let the draw points refresh. Once you have 100 of each, Junction the magic you drew and your massive stat increase will show you why this aspect of the game is broken.
#4. Increasing Crisis Level for Multi-Hit Limit Breaks
The ultimate damage cap for a single hit attack is 60K but several characters have multi-hit Limit Breaks. With Irvine and Zell, you can physically control the number of hits dealt with a single Limit Break. Access to them and the length of time you have to execute them is determined by Crisis Level. Using Aura, which are refined with Supt Mag-RF from Steel Pipes that you can get from Elastoid Cards or by fighting Wendigos, or increasing your HP early by refining Tents into Curagas with L Mag-RF and staying below the 10% mark are easy ways to increase your Crisis Level. Stacking these with Status Effects can allow Zell’s Limit Break to reach damage limits up into the millions by repeating the two button combos.
#3. Not Leveling to keep Enemy Levels Low
Monsters and bosses scaling in difficulty with the average level of your active party isn’t a broken game mechanic by itself. In FFVIII, however, character stats increase more by Junctioning magic, and because of the powerful magic you can get early on by means I will outline in #1, the Junctioning system is very broken. Not gaining experience by escaping battles can make you OP enough to one-hit both monsters and bosses. Because bosses don’t give EXP, you can complete the entire game without gaining a single level by either carding or casting Break to petrify monsters in the unavoidable, inescapable battles.
#2. Refining Cards into Items that give GF Stat-Boosts
Zell’s Card, which you can win from Ma Dincht right after you return from the Dollet Mission, refines into 3 Hyper Wrists, each one can teach a GF Str+60%. Before leaving for Timber, you can win the Mini-Mog Card from the running kid in Balamb Garden and then lose it to the Card Queen in Balamb. If you talk to her after losing, she will say she’s heading to Dollet. If you talk to her about her father in the Dollet Pub you can then win the Kiros Card from the man in black standing on the side of the street in Deling City. The Kiros Card refines into 3 Accelerators, each one being able to teach a GF the Auto-Haste ability.
#1. Refining Cards into Items that Refine into Magic
Gayla Cards refine into Mystery Fluid, which with ST Mag-RF, refine into 10 Meltdowns, which (besides Ultima & Triple) is the best Junctioning spell for Vitality. Tri-Face Cards refine into Curse Spikes, which with ST Mag-RF, refine into 10 Pains, which (besides Triple and Ultima) is the best Junctioning spell for Magic. The Quistis Card (which you can get from the back Trepe Groupie in the Cafeteria at the start of the game) refines into 3 Samantha Souls, which refines into 60 Triples each. Prioritize learning Quetzalcoatl’s Card Mod and Diablos’ Time Mag-RF and you can get the second best Junctioning spell before you even leave for Timber.
Those are the top 5 ways to break Final Fantasy VIII. You can also get the Lion Heart on Disc 1 (there are youtube walkthroughs for that) but considering the Limit Break it gives is also determined by Crisis Level, I’d consider that a part of #4: Increasing Crisis Level for Multi-Hit Limit Breaks.
